Hi Massimo,

The question is how to upgrade my system, by steps, and in which sequence, knowing that I’m probably aiming for a 500 series setup ultimately.

I can’t do all at once as it’s too costly (and less fun?) and I don’t want to take too many steps either as it costs more to do it that way.

I’m not changing my speakers and my 300DR until probably much later. Then it leaves the source and preamp, where I have a great combo today with 272/555ps.

I thought i could get Naim’s best source as in the ND555 and that the 272 (as preamp) would still do it justice but in my ears, it’s not quite the case.

So, next I will demo the 252DR/SC in place of the 272, together with the ND555. And I should also probably try the 252DR/SC as preamp without the ND555 but keeping the 272/555ps as streamer. Let’s see…. or rather let’s hear…

Why not, before having the funds for the Nd555, purchase a second hand Nds, which is the second best Naim streamer.
252/SC / Nds/ 555 dr would be much more ahead of 272/ 555dr.
You can find Nds for 3k. Sell the 272 and get the Nds.
Only one caveat: no native Qobuz .
